After 21 years doing business as D-Best Tub/Shower Installation & Repairs, Daniel & Connie Jimenez were contemplating closure of the business due to the slow-down in construction. In 2007, their daughter Vanessa, learned the business from the ground-up under the tutelage for her parents and formed Best Bath.

Founded by brothers Billy and Mark Blackwell, Bilmar Landscape has grown from a small operation based in a family garage to approximately 100 employees serving over 300 homeowners associations in Southern Nevada. The company philosophy is “we are in the people business and our byproduct is landscape maintenance.”
Carol Levins
Creative Kids Learning Centers
Year Established: 1980
Founded in 1980 by owner Carol Levins, Creative Kids has grown to become the state’s largest family-owned child care center chain in Nevada. The company operates eight centers and employs over 160 people. Carol’s son, Jared Hall, and daughter, Heather Jones, are both involved in the business.

Founded by Carlos and Adriana Banchik, the engineering firm couples numerous technology tools with sound engineering principles. It is one of a handful of firms throughout the nation that uses Sofistik, a German software program, for analysis, design and detailing for building projects.
Christy Stevens, Craig & Susan Miller
Pictographics
Year Established: 1994
Craig and Susan Miller, along with their daughter Christy Stevens, founded the large format digital print business. Initially, interior casino signage was the company’s primary product. Today over 90 percent of its business is out-of-market. The company provides total visual solutions utilizing dozens of technologies.
